Why Nuku''alofa Needs Double-Glass Photovoltaic Curtain Walls

Nuku''alofa, the capital of Tonga, faces unique energy challenges as a small island nation. With rising electricity costs and a growing focus on sustainability, double-glass photovoltaic curtain walls offer a dual solution: energy generation and architectural innovation. These systems integrate solar panels into building façades, turning structures into self-sufficient power hubs. But how do you market this technology effectively here?

The Growing Demand for Solar Solutions in Tonga

According to the Tonga Energy Roadmap (TERM), the country aims to generate 70% of its electricity from renewables by 2025. This creates a prime opportunity for solar technologies like photovoltaic curtain walls. Let''s break down the market drivers:

  • High solar potential: Tonga receives 5-6 kWh/m² of daily solar radiation, ideal for energy harvesting.
  • Government incentives: Grants and tax rebates for green building projects.
  • Urban development: Nuku''alofa''s construction boom prioritizes energy-efficient designs.

Key Benefits of Double-Glass Photovoltaic Curtain Walls

Imagine a building that acts as both a shelter and a power plant. That''s the promise of this technology. Here''s why it''s a game-changer:

  • Energy savings: Reduces grid dependency by up to 40%, cutting operational costs.
  • Aesthetic flexibility: Customizable designs blend with traditional Polynesian architecture.
  • Durability: Double-glass layers withstand cyclones, a critical feature for Tonga''s climate.

Case Study: Solar Success in the South Pacific

In 2023, EK SOLAR installed a 200 kW photovoltaic curtain wall at a resort in Fiji, achieving:

MetricResult
Annual Energy Generation280 MWh
Cost Savings$45,000/year
ROI Period6.2 years

This demonstrates the viability of similar projects in Nuku''alofa.
